Library Friends General Meeting  April 12, 2008

"How a Book is Built"

“How a Book is Built” was presented by Brian Hotchkiss, executive director of Vern Associates, at the general meeting of the Friends of Lynnfield Library on Saturday, April 12, 2008.  Mr. Hotchkiss discussed how books are built from start to finish, using samples of books in various stages of development.  Vern Associates of Newburyport is known for making high-quality illustrated books for museums, non-profit organizations, and corporations, see: www.vernassoc.com.  Of local interest, Vern Associates recently packaged Dean Lahikainen’s book Samuel McIntire: Carving an American Style about McIntire, who contributed to the cultural heritage of Salem, Massachusetts by designing several buildings there, and providing ornamental decoration for buildings, furniture, and woodwork.

The Friends of the Lynnfield Library comprise over 300 Lynnfield residents.  Members of the organization last year volunteered hundreds of hours and raised thousands of dollars to support activities provided by the Library.
